The 1970s produced a peculiar school of singer-songwriters whose narrative-driven lyrics set them apart from their self-reflective peers. Think of David Ackles and Randy Newman on the fringes, and far nearer the mainstream, the "Captain Jack"-era Billy Joel and earnest-to-the-core Harry Chapin. Chapin first made a splash in 1972 with "Taxi," a claustrophobic little melodrama set in a cab. He made the top 20 two years later with the familial "Cat's in the Cradle." Though he'd never climb so high again, songs such as "W*O*L*D" and "Dance Band on the Titanic," and albums like Verities & Balderdash kept the folk crooner in the spotlight. From there, he championed a variety of social causes until he was killed in a 1981 auto accident. Story of a Life packages three discs of Chapin recordings in one attractive box. Given the singer's excesses (he wasn't the subtlest of artists, either as a writer or singer), that's a lot of Chapin. But fans will appreciate the loving liner essays from family members and, of course, the cinematic songs from a performer whose heart was always in the right place. --Steven Stolder

This isn't a collection for someone who is trying to get to know Harry Chapin and his music. It is, however, a collection for people who already love Harry Chapin and are collecting his works.

Die-hard fans know that Harry had a few different versions of some of his songs (i.e. Circle)and this set offers a few new ones.

The recordings between the songs are super, and show a bit of Harry's great sense of humor and his sense of concern for those who are going hungry.

If you don't know Harry Chapin, don't make this the first album of his that you buy. But if you love Harry, this is a must-have for your collection.

As a lifelong Harry Chapin fan, I have been frustrated for many years at the absence of his best work from CD. This collection captures the essence of his work from his best known songs such as Taxi and Cats in the Cradle to lesser known (but better) works as well. Of particular note is the excellent sound quality as compared with earlier collections. This should easily have been a 4-CD collection. One can only hope that this collection is a success so that Harry's other albums, such as Short Stories, Sequel and Legends of the Lost and Found (in my opinion, the superior "live album)are released. However, for those wanting a rounded collection of Harry Chapin's work, this is it.
